Examples of SCORNS in a Sentence

  1. Azel Backus:

    Error always addresses the passions and prejudices; truth scorns such mean intrigue, and only addresses the understanding and the conscience.

  2. John W. Gardner:

    The society which scorns excellence in plumbing as a humble activity and tolerates shoddiness in philosophy because it is an exalted activity will have neither good plumbing nor good philosophy...neither its pipes nor its theories will hold water.

  4. Robert G. Ingersoll:

    When the will defies fear, when duty throws the gauntlet down to fate, when honor scorns to compromise with death -- that is heroism.
